things from the novelization/manga that were missing (some might have been just for the manga/novel though):
1. Zhao temping Aang with a bucket of water or something.
2. The Dragon Spirit telling Aang about Sozin's Comet.
3. Katara losing her necklace and Aang getting it back.
4. the fortuneteller/medium
5. Sokka calling Katara a "baby-bender"
6. Aang asks Katara about her necklace in Southern Water Tribe
7. Sokka asks Yue if his grandmother asked what would she say her feelings were for him, and she says he is her best friend.
